Fix ARM runner build issues by installing C++ build tools
Some checks failed
Lint and Build / build (pull_request) Failing after 27s

- Add automatic detection and installation of build-essential
- Support Ubuntu/Debian, Alpine, and RHEL/CentOS ARM runners
- Resolves 'c++: No such file or directory' error for native modules
- Ensures bufferutil and other native dependencies can compile

- name: Install build dependencies
run: |
if command -v apt-get >/dev/null 2>&1; then
sudo apt-get update
sudo apt-get install -y build-essential python3-dev
elif command -v apk >/dev/null 2>&1; then
sudo apk add --no-cache build-base python3-dev
elif command -v yum >/dev/null 2>&1; then
sudo yum groupinstall -y "Development Tools"
sudo yum install -y python3-devel
fi
